Macrolides, characterized by their large lactone ring structure, primarily exert their effects by inhibiting bacterial protein synthesis. This mechanism makes them particularly effective against Gram-positive bacteria and mycoplasmas, common pathogens responsible for significant animal diseases. Their ability to penetrate host cells, such as macrophages, further enhances their therapeutic efficacy by concentrating at sites of infection and inflammation, contributing to improved pharmacokinetic profiles and sometimes longer dosing intervals.

Tilmicosin Phosphate, a prominent member of the 16-membered ring macrolide group, exemplifies these beneficial characteristics. Its efficacy in treating conditions like Bovine Respiratory Disease (BRD) in cattle and enzootic pneumonia in sheep is a testament to its broad antibacterial spectrum. Unlike some other macrolides, certain derivatives like Tilmicosin have a broader spectrum that includes key Gram-negative pathogens relevant to animal respiratory diseases, such as *Mannheimia haemolytica* and *Pasteurella multocida*.

Beyond its direct antibacterial action, some macrolides are also noted for their immunomodulatory effects, which can be beneficial in treating complex infections where inflammation plays a significant role. While this aspect requires further research for specific compounds like Tilmicosin Phosphate in all contexts, the general properties of macrolides contribute to their success in veterinary practice.
